WebbDeclaration of std::vector. The declaration syntax of std::vector is the same as that of std::array, with the difference that we don't need to specify the array length along with … Webb1 dec. 2016 · Copy std::vector into std::array which doesn't assume a type without default constructor, so copying after default initialization is feasible there but not for …
Most C++ constructors should be `explicit` – Arthur O
WebbA typical vector implementation consists, internally, of a pointer to a dynamically allocated array, [1] and possibly data members holding the capacity and size of the vector. The size of the vector refers to the actual number of elements, while the capacity refers to the size of the internal array. Webb30 nov. 2024 · A 3D vector is a type of vector having 3 Dimensions means a vector storing a 2-D vector inside it, similar to a 2-D array. There are a few methods to … top 10 best thick wet washcloths
Most C++ constructors should be `explicit` – Arthur O
WebbThe first axis has a length of 2, the second axis has a length of 3. [[ 1., 0., 0.], [ 0., 1., 2.]] NumPy’s array class is called ndarray. It is also known by the alias array. Note that numpy.array is not the same as the Standard Python Library class array.array, which only handles one-dimensional arrays and offers less functionality. Webb16 jan. 2024 · Following are different ways to create and initialize a vector in C++ STL 1, Initializing by one by one pushing values : 一个一个初始化 // CPP program to … Webb6 apr. 2024 · List and vector are both container classes in C++, but they have fundamental differences in the way they store and manipulate data. List stores elements in a linked list structure, while vector stores elements in a dynamically allocated array. Each container has its own advantages and disadvantages, and choosing the right container that … pibby pucca